Output 89afa1b9a484e5083d5df2c53a0f79a3781aecbfd9a120aad778b3d2a8344396:28

value
303384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e002653727751ec56c319dcc0cdbc26675e9658 OP_EQUAL
address
3BieS3gzmio86fQ4soc5gKt8JvoBF2WhAy
transaction
89afa1b9a484e5083d5df2c53a0f79a3781aecbfd9a120aad778b3d2a8344396
spent
true